Abstract

High pollutant level has caused an increase in disease that is correlated to Reactive Oxygen Species through a condition that is oxidative stress. Oxidative stress can be stabilized with antioxidants by stabilizing active and unstable radicals to become inactive and stable. Basil leaves (Ocimum x africanum lour) are known to posses antioxidant composition. The aim of this study is to determine the antioxidant ability and toxicity level of basil leaves. The research was conducted through an in vitro experimental study design and bioassays. Extraction of this research was carried out by maceration method using methanol as solvent. The tests were carried out in the form of antioxidant capacity tests using the 1,1-diphenyl-2-picrylhydrazyl method, toxicity tests using the brine shrimph lethality test method on Basil Leaf extract. In basil leaf extract, the antioxidant capacity test obtained IC50 of 174.04 μg/mL, phenolic level test was 10872,92 mg/mL, alkaloid level test was 8.15 μg/mL, toxicity test obtained LC50 of 158.36 μg/mL. This study concludes that basil leaves contain antioxidants not as much as vitamin C however basil leaves do not have an effect that triggers an increase in stomach acid, so it has potential as an alternative antioxidant for a patient with stomach acid disorder, in addition, basil leaves also have cytotoxicity activity that is possible to be used as anti-carsinogen.
